Surfactant measurement device (potentiometric automatic titration device)
Easy measurement of surfactants using a dedicated electrode with an automatic titration device!
Surfactants (anionic, cationic, nonionic) can be easily measured using a dedicated electrode with an automatic titration device. Complicated and time-consuming pretreatment is not necessary. The concentration of various surfactants can be accurately measured in a short time using the same process as conventional titration methods. By changing the electrode, general potentiometric titrations (such as neutralization titrations or precipitation titrations) can also be performed, of course. It is also convenient for measuring cleaning solutions and wastewater in manufacturing sites.
basic information
**Features** - Easy titration with dedicated electrodes for the metronome only - Measurement of anions, cations, and non-ions is possible - Measurement of anionic surfactants without using chloroform - Measurement of surfactants in organic solvents (non-aqueous systems) is also possible - No need for time-consuming and complex pre-treatment processes - Continuous measurement of multiple samples is possible by connecting a sample changer - Can be connected to a sample processor that accommodates 160 samples or custom containers - Complies with FDA 21 CFR Part 11 (only when using PC software tiamo)
